Patent number: 12372108Abstract: A rotatable forkend connection system is provided that includes a shank and a forkend connector. The shank is fixedly coupled to a device member and extends within the device member along a longitudinal axis of the device member. The shank includes a protrusion extending from the shank in a direction perpendicular to the longitudinal axis of the device member. The forkend connector is rotatably coupled to the shank and has an axis of rotation coaxial with the longitudinal axis of the device member. The forkend connector includes a recess configured to receive the protrusion. The protrusion and the recess are configured to restrain the forkend connector from moving along the longitudinal axis of the device member.Type: GrantFiled: March 26, 2021Date of Patent: July 29, 2025Assignee: Xtreme Structures & Fabrication, LLCInventors: Michael Wells, Mark Newlin, Clifton Robbins

Patent number: 12344301Abstract: A pivotal joint structure is connected to a front leg and a bottom pipe of a stroller. The pivotal joint structure includes a connecting component disposed in the bottom pipe. A first end of the connecting component is fixedly connected to the front leg. The pivotal joint structure further includes an inner fixing component and an outer fixing component, which are disposed in the bottom pipe and connected to the bottom pipe. The connecting component is disposed between the inner fixing component and the outer fixing component, and the inner fixing component and the outer fixing component are rotatable around the connecting component. The front leg can be further folded relative to the bottom pipe by the pivotal joint structure. Therefore, the occupied space of the folded stroller can be further reduced, so as to facilitate carrying and storage when not in use.Type: GrantFiled: December 30, 2021Date of Patent: July 1, 2025Assignee: WONDERLAND SWITZERLAND AGInventor: Haibo Zeng

Patent number: 12297907Abstract: A water-proof sealing structure for vehicle roof racks includes a sealing member which includes a first end, a second end and a shank formed between the first and second ends. The first end of the sealing member includes a first sealing portion which seals the inner periphery of a male end of a first pipe of the vehicle roof rack. The second end of the sealing member includes a second sealing portion which seals the opening of the male end and also seals the inner periphery of a female end of a second pipe of the vehicle roof rack. The shank has a positioning hole defined radially therethrough. A bolt extends through the first and second pipes and the positioning hole to connect the male end to the female end. The positioning hole is a tapered hole to allow the bolt to be movable therein.Type: GrantFiled: July 8, 2019Date of Patent: May 13, 2025Assignee: KING RACK INDUSTRIAL CO., LTD.Inventor: Chiu Kuei Wang

Patent number: 12241501Abstract: A channel fastener for fastening to an elongate channel element including a washer element, an oblong anchoring element and a connecting element which connects the anchoring element to the washer element, while allowing the anchoring element to rotate with respect to the washer element. The fastener includes a torque-inducing element fixed to the anchoring element and includes at least one resiliently deformable limb arranged substantially offset from the rotational axis of the anchoring element and adapted for a sliding engagement with a flange of the channel element. When the anchoring element is inserted through the longitudinal slot into the channel element, the limb deforms while sliding along the flange towards the interior of the channel element, whereby a torque on the anchoring element is induced, which rotates the anchoring element towards a locking position in which it cannot be retracted through the longitudinal slot of the channel element.Type: GrantFiled: February 21, 2020Date of Patent: March 4, 2025Assignee: J. Patent number: 12227959Abstract: A barrier is formed from bollards and posts that are embedded in a terrain. The bollards and posts are interconnected by, and support, vertically-spaced runs of primary rails. The rails in each run are aligned in end-to-end relationship. A strengthening cable extends within each run, and is anchored at each end within a concrete-filled bollard. Each bollard contains an elongate, vertically-oriented cable entry port that can receive the end portions of all of the cables in the runs, disposed in laterally-spaced relationship. A two-part closure covers the cable entry port, and includes spaced cable openings that maintain the cables that exit the bollard at a desired lateral separation distance. A cable confinement bracket installed at each post prevents the cables from flying out of the primary rails after an impact. The bracket features a spine that restrains the cables, which pass through bays notched in the spine's lower edge.Type: GrantFiled: January 6, 2022Date of Patent: February 18, 2025Assignee: Ameristar Perimeter Security USA Inc.Inventors: Robert W Nichols, Michael D Elmore
